In underground coal combustion in the gas phase several reactions take place, including CO + ½ O2 ? CO2 H2 + ½ O2 ? H2O CH4 + 3/2 O2 ? CO + 2 H2O where the CO, H2, and CH4 come from coal pyrolysis. If a gas phase composed of CO 13.54 %, CO2 15.22 %, H2 15.01 %, CH4 3.20 %, and the balance N2 is burned with 40 % excess air, (a) how much air is needed per 100 moles of gas, and (b) what will be the analysis of the product gas on a wet basis?
